Understanding the Physics of the Descent
The seemingly random path of the plinko disc is, in fact, governed by the laws of physics, albeit in a complex and chaotic manner. Each impact with a peg results in a transfer of energy, altering the disc's trajectory. While predicting the exact path is virtually impossible due to the numerous variables involved – the initial release point, the precise angle of impact, the elasticity of the pegs – certain patterns and probabilities emerge. The distribution of pegs on the board significantly impacts where the disc is likely to land, with wider spaces generally leading to more unpredictable results and narrower spaces funneling the disc towards specific slots. Understanding these basic principles can provide a slight edge, although luck remains the dominant factor.
The Role of Peg Placement and Board Design
The configuration of the pegs is paramount to the game’s structure and potential payout dynamics. Designers carefully consider the placement to influence the game’s variance: a low variance arrangement spreads the potential winnings across multiple slots, resulting in more frequent but smaller payouts, whereas a high variance setup concentrates the rewards in fewer slots, creating the possibility of substantial wins but with a lower probability. The material of the pegs also plays a role – softer materials dampen the impact, reducing the rebound angle, while harder materials create more erratic bounces. The overall gradient of the board is another crucial aspect, affecting the disc’s speed and influencing its interaction with the pegs.
| Peg Configuration | Variance | Payout Frequency | Typical Payout Size |
|---|---|---|---|
| Closely Spaced | Low | High | Small |
| Widely Spaced | High | Low | Large |
| Asymmetrical | Moderate to High | Moderate | Variable |
| Symmetrical | Moderate | Moderate | Stable |
Examining the interplay between these design elements reveals the thought process behind plinko board construction. Builders are essentially sculpting probability landscapes, manipulating the chances of winning to capture the desired level of excitement and player engagement. The optimal design is often a balance between predictability and surprise, allowing for the occasional large payoff to keep players hopeful, while ensuring a consistent flow of smaller rewards to maintain interest.

Beyond Entertainment: Exploring Randomness and Probability
The inherent randomness of the plinko game provides a fascinating model for exploring broader concepts in probability and statistical analysis. While seemingly simple, the game demonstrates the power of chaotic systems and the difficulties of predicting outcomes in complex environments. Considering the board as a physical representation of a probabilistic distribution, it provides a concrete framework for understanding concepts such as expected value, variance, and the law of large numbers. Analyzing the results of numerous plinko games can reveal insights into these principles, offering a practical application of theoretical statistical concepts.
